My Buying Guides on Glass Bowl Set With Lids

Why I Prefer Glass Bowl Sets With Lids

When I shop for kitchen storage, I usually look for glass bowl sets with lids because they feel more practical and reliable than many plastic alternatives. I like that glass does not absorb odors or stains easily, and it helps me see what I have stored without opening every container. For me, that makes meal prep, leftovers, and pantry organization much easier.

What I Look for in the Glass Quality

The first thing I check is the quality of the glass. I prefer tempered or borosilicate glass because it feels sturdier and handles temperature changes better. In my experience, thicker glass gives me more confidence when I use the bowls for mixing, storing, or reheating food.

Why Lid Fit Matters to Me

I always pay close attention to the lids. A tight-fitting lid is important because it helps keep food fresh and prevents spills in the fridge or during transport. I usually look for lids that snap on securely or seal well with silicone. If the lids feel loose, I know I will probably regret the purchase later.

Size Variety I Find Most Useful

I like sets that include multiple bowl sizes because they give me more flexibility. Small bowls are great for sauces, snacks, and chopped ingredients, while larger bowls work well for salads, mixing, and storing leftovers. A good set for me usually includes a balanced mix of sizes so I do not have to buy extra containers later.

Microwave, Oven, and Freezer Safety

One of the biggest things I check is whether the bowls are safe for microwave, oven, and freezer use. I find this especially helpful because I often want to store food and reheat it in the same dish. Still, I always make sure to read the product instructions carefully, especially for the lids, since many lids are not oven-safe.

How Easy They Are to Clean

Cleaning is a big part of my buying decision. I prefer glass bowl sets that are dishwasher-safe because that saves me time and effort. I also like lids that are easy to wash and do not trap food in hard-to-reach corners. For me, simple cleaning is a major sign of a well-designed set.

Storage and Stackability

I try to choose sets that stack neatly inside one another or fit well in my cabinets. Space matters in my kitchen, so I appreciate bowls and lids that do not create clutter. Nesting designs are especially helpful because they make storage much more organized and efficient.

What I Consider About Durability

Durability is important because I want a set that lasts. I usually look for bowls that can handle daily use without chipping easily. I also check whether the lids are made from strong, BPA-free material. In my experience, a durable set may cost a little more, but it often saves money over time.

Safety and Material Concerns

I always prefer BPA-free lids and food-safe materials. Even though glass is generally a safer choice than some plastics, I still make sure the entire set is designed for food storage. If I am buying for family use, this becomes even more important to me.

My Final Buying Tip

When I choose a glass bowl set with lids, I focus on glass quality, lid seal, size variety, and ease of cleaning. If a set performs well in those areas, it usually becomes one of my most-used kitchen items. For me, the best set is the one that feels versatile, durable, and easy to live with every day.
